Episode 30 of The Quantum Computing Podcast with Fexingo dives into the latest milestone in quantum factoring: the 2026 demonstration of factoring a 1,099-digit integer using Shor's algorithm on a 256-qubit superconducting processor. Lucas and Luna break down why this is a bigger deal than previous records, how error mitigation made it possible, and what it means for RSA encryption timelines. They discuss the specific techniques used—zero-noise extrapolation and probabilistic error cancellation—and why the result is more about algorithmic maturity than breaking crypto tomorrow.
